Join Anthony SanFilippo every Thursday as he and goes around the world of sports.

Episodes recorded earlier in the week (Monday or Tuesday) will often feature long-time Philadelphia sports writer Bob Cooney and other On Pattison writers like Anthony and Tim Kelly.

On Pattison Podcast Episode 26: The Future of Citizens Bank Park
Q: From a big picture sense, what were your general thoughts on her reaction to the renaming of Harry the K's?
Matt Breen explains that the widow felt the legacy was being disrespected, emphasizing the balance between honoring Harry Kalas and the Phillies' business decisions, while noting the broadcast booth and statue remain, keeping Harry's memory visible even as rights deals change.
On Pattison Podcast Episode 21: 2026 Phillies season preview w/ Tim Kelly, Bob Cooney and Ty Daubert!
Q: What are the biggest positives you see in this Phillies team this year?
The rotation could be even better, Painter is starting, and the team has a bonafide all-star closer again, plus the core hitters like Schwarber, Harper, and Turner form a powerful top three; Rob Thompson's management and Schwarber's return add to the positives.
On Pattison Podcast Episode 21: 2026 Phillies season preview w/ Tim Kelly, Bob Cooney and Ty Daubert!
Q: What does Rob Thompson do that you really appreciate, and what are some things you scratch your head about?
Thompson is even-keeled with a veteran group, provides steady leadership, understands the players and keeps a balanced approach, sometimes ends up appeasing critics in media with his composed demeanor, but generally earns trust for maintaining stability and consistency.

Frequently Asked Questions About On Pattison Podcast

What is On Pattison Podcast about and what kind of topics does it cover?

A sports-focused conversation hosted by Anthony SanFilippo with a rotating cast of Philly reporters and contributors. Episodes center on Philadelphia teams—Eagles, Sixers, Flyers, and Phillies—blending game analysis, trade talk, coaching moves, and local sports culture with plenty of banter and long-form storytelling. A standout is the chemistry among veteran local writers who bring insider context, season-long arcs, and city-wide passion to every chat.
